Fifth Era Acquisition Corp I (FERA) is trading at a current price of $10.34, posting a minor gain of 0.05% in recent trading sessions. This analysis covers key technical levels, sector context, and potential price scenarios for the special purpose acquisition company (SPAC), as market participants monitor for updates on its ongoing business combination search. Market Context

Recent trading volume for FERA has been in line with historical averages, with no sustained spikes or drop-offs in activity observed this month. This muted volume aligns with broader trends across the blank-check acquisition sector, where many SPACs have traded in narrow ranges as investors wait for concrete updates on target acquisition plans. The broader SPAC segment has seen mixed performance recently, with firms that have clearly outlined their target investment verticals drawing more investor interest than those with vague search parameters. Broader small-cap market sentiment has been cautiously optimistic this month, with low levels of implied volatility reducing wild price swings across speculative segments like SPACs, which has helped keep FERA’s price stable near its current level. Market participants note that SPAC trading flows have become more closely tied to acquisition progress updates in recent weeks, as investors prioritize clarity over speculative positioning.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, FERA has well-defined near-term support and resistance levels that have held consistently in recent weeks. The primary support level sits at $9.82, a price point that has attracted buying interest every time the stock has pulled back to that level in recent trading, acting as a reliable floor for price action. The primary resistance level is at $10.86, a threshold that has repeatedly capped upward moves, as selling pressure has increased each time FERA has approached that price. Momentum indicators for FERA are currently in neutral territory, with its relative strength index (RSI) in the mid-40s, signaling no extreme overbought or oversold conditions that would suggest an imminent sharp price move. The stock is also trading roughly in line with its short-term moving averages, confirming that it is in a consolidation phase for the time being, with no clear directional bias evident from technical signals alone.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two key technical scenarios to monitor for FERA in the upcoming weeks. If the stock breaks above the $10.86 resistance level on higher-than-average volume, that could signal a shift to more bullish sentiment among market participants, potentially leading to an expansion of the trading range to the upside. Conversely, if FERA falls below the $9.82 support level on elevated trading volume, that might indicate rising bearish sentiment, possibly leading to tests of lower price levels in the near term. It is important to note that technical levels are only guides, and price action for FERA would likely be dominated by any company-specific announcements related to its proposed business combination, which are the primary catalysts for SPAC price moves. Broader market sentiment shifts, such as changes in small-cap risk appetite, could also impact FERA’s trading pattern, even in the absence of company-specific news.
